I never said it was the worst thing I've ever seen, but it was a non-hockey attack on an unaware--and thus defenseless--player. It is an inherently egregious offense.

I do not qualify my sentiments within the context of the inconsistent and incompetent NHL disciplinary system, because I prefer to contextualize my arguments in intelligent ways. Unfortunately for me and my arguments, the NHL is both entirely incompetent when dealing with these sorts of things and simultaneously the authoritative voice on them.

Cooke on Savard was a vicious hit. It was a hit which largely created the current bumbling attempts at increasing player safety through increased discipline for hits targeting the head. A previous--and perhaps even more incompetent--chief of NHL disciplinary action was involved in that decision. Not suspending Cooke was the wrong choice. It was made by a man who is no longer employed in the business of making those decisions. It was also made before several rule changes related to those sorts of hits.

It happened many years ago. Cooke is no longer a Penguin. The NHL disciplinary process has changed, and there are different people in charge of it. That play bears no relevance whatsoever to this discussion. Even if it did bear relevance to this discussion, Cooke's actions can and should in no way dictate my own opinions and the validity of those opinions, so you cannot use those actions to marginalize me (or any other Penguins fan, for that matter) as a member of this discussion.

I am on very public record (my posts in this website) saying James Neal's suspension was largely insufficient. I have shown time and again to be able to make at least reasonably unbiased arguments about issues in the league and on the ice, even when my team is involved.
